The appeal

Ducati’s tribute to its champion superstar, Carl Fogarty, had to be exceptional. And it certainly was. The ‘Foggy Monster’ combined the brand’s superb 916cc Desmodromic V-twin engine with a trellis frame and decals designed by Aldo Drudi, the designer of Rossi’s helmets, to produce what is arguably one of the greatest special editions of the last 30 years.
Only 300 were made, all sold exclusively online. Thirteen were allocated to France, and this example, with very low mileage and a single owner, is number three. The seller describes it as being in concours condition and reports that it is entirely original. It has recently been serviced and fitted with new tyres. It comes with all factory accessories, including the ‘race kit’ with its Termignoni exhausts, which could increase power from 101 ch to 110 ch.
With standard French registration, this is a rare opportunity to acquire one of the most sought-after modern Ducatis amongst collectors.
